Smart Transportation Market: Growth, Trends, and Forecast (2025-2034)

The smart transportation market is revolutionizing the way people and goods move, leveraging advanced technologies like IoT, AI, and big data to improve efficiency, safety, and sustainability. The market reached a value of about USD 161.23 billion in 2024 and is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 17.2% from 2025 to 2034. This growth will bring the market size to an estimated USD 671.31 billion by 2034. The emergence of smart city initiatives, government investments in infrastructure, and technological advancements are key factors driving this growth.

This article explores the global smart transportation market, discussing its size, market dynamics, growth factors, opportunities, challenges, and key players shaping the future of transportation.

Market Overview


Smart transportation refers to the integration of innovative technologies and systems into the transportation network, enhancing mobility, reducing traffic congestion, improving road safety, and reducing the environmental impact of transportation. The use of connected vehicles, intelligent traffic management systems, and data analytics is transforming how transportation systems operate globally.

The growing demand for real-time traffic monitoring, autonomous vehicles, and environmentally-friendly transportation solutions are key drivers behind the evolution of the smart transportation market. As urbanization continues to increase, governments, municipalities, and private entities are investing in developing sustainable and efficient transportation infrastructure. This transformation is expected to significantly boost the adoption of smart transportation solutions across various sectors, including public transport, logistics, and personal vehicles.

Size & Share of the Smart Transportation Market


The global smart transportation market reached a value of approximately USD 161.23 billion in 2024. It is expected to grow at a robust CAGR of 17.2% during the forecast period from 2025 to 2034. By the end of 2034, the market size is projected to reach approximately USD 671.31 billion.

The market can be divided into various segments based on solutions, applications, and regions. In terms of solutions, intelligent transportation systems (ITS) hold the largest market share, followed by connected vehicles and autonomous vehicles. The increasing adoption of electric vehicles (EVs) is another factor contributing to the growth of the smart transportation market.

Geographically, North America and Europe are currently the dominant markets for smart transportation due to their advanced infrastructure and technological capabilities. However, the Asia-Pacific region is expected to witness the highest growth during the forecast period, driven by the increasing adoption of smart city initiatives and the growing demand for smart mobility solutions in countries like China, Japan, and India.

Market Dynamics & Trends


Several factors are influencing the growth of the smart transportation market. These factors can be categorized into market dynamics and trends, which are shaping the direction of the industry.

  1. Government Initiatives and Regulations :Governments around the world are implementing policies and investing in infrastructure to promote smart transportation solutions. For instance, governments in developed regions like North America and Europe are focusing on sustainable transportation systems to reduce emissions and promote environmental sustainability. Smart transportation systems, such as intelligent traffic management systems, are being developed to enhance road safety, reduce congestion, and improve mobility.

  2. Technological Advancements :Technological innovations are at the core of the smart transportation market. Advances in IoT, AI, big data analytics, and 5G technology have enabled the development of connected vehicles, real-time traffic management systems, and smart traffic lights. These technologies allow vehicles and infrastructure to communicate with each other, enhancing the overall efficiency and safety of transportation systems.

  3. Growth of Electric and Autonomous Vehicles :The rising adoption of electric vehicles (EVs) and autonomous vehicles is another important trend influencing the smart transportation market. EVs contribute to reducing greenhouse gas emissions, while autonomous vehicles have the potential to enhance road safety, reduce traffic congestion, and optimize fuel efficiency.

  4. Urbanization and Smart Cities :With rapid urbanization, the need for smarter, more efficient transportation systems has never been greater. Smart cities, which are built with the integration of technology to optimize resource usage, are increasingly adopting smart transportation systems to improve mobility, sustainability, and quality of life for urban dwellers. The deployment of electric buses, smart traffic management systems, and shared mobility solutions is expected to be central to the development of smart cities worldwide.


Growth of the Smart Transportation Market


The smart transportation market is poised for substantial growth over the next decade due to the following factors:

  1. Increasing Demand for Smart Mobility Solutions :With the growing need for more efficient, sustainable, and convenient transportation options, smart mobility solutions, including ride-sharing services, car-sharing programs, and electric vehicles, are gaining popularity. The shift toward shared mobility services and the rise of on-demand transportation solutions are driving market expansion, especially in urban areas.

  2. Rising Need for Sustainable Transportation Solutions :The push for sustainability is becoming more prominent, particularly in light of climate change concerns and the need to reduce carbon emissions. Smart transportation systems, which include EVs, electric buses, and low-emission vehicles, are seen as key enablers of green mobility. Governments and organizations are increasingly encouraging the adoption of these technologies to minimize the environmental impact of traditional transportation systems.

  3. Advancements in Autonomous Vehicle Technology :Self-driving cars and trucks are expected to revolutionize the transportation sector. Autonomous vehicles have the potential to reduce accidents caused by human error, decrease traffic congestion, and optimize traffic flow. The rapid advancements in autonomous vehicle technology are anticipated to fuel market growth, with major players in the automotive industry actively investing in the development of autonomous systems.

  4. Expansion of 5G Networks :5G technology will play a crucial role in the development of smart transportation systems. The ultra-low latency and high-speed connectivity provided by 5G will enable seamless communication between vehicles, infrastructure, and traffic management systems, facilitating the growth of autonomous driving and connected vehicles. The rollout of 5G networks worldwide will enhance the performance of smart transportation solutions.

Market Opportunities and Challenges


Opportunities:

  1. Integration of Smart Infrastructure in Emerging Markets Emerging markets, particularly in Asia-Pacific and Latin America, present a significant opportunity for the smart transportation market. As urbanization continues to accelerate in these regions, there is an increasing demand for smart infrastructure, including intelligent traffic management systems and smart transportation networks.

  2. Collaboration with Technology Providers Collaboration between transportation companies and technology providers (such as IT and telecommunications firms) is opening up new opportunities for innovation in smart transportation solutions. By working together, these companies can create more advanced and integrated systems that improve mobility and connectivity.

  3. Public-Private Partnerships Public-private partnerships (PPP) can drive the development of smart transportation infrastructure. Governments can collaborate with private enterprises to fund and implement advanced transportation technologies, such as autonomous vehicles and electric public transport systems, to improve urban mobility.


Challenges:

  1. High Initial Investment The initial investment required for the implementation of smart transportation systems can be substantial. Developing and upgrading infrastructure to support smart transportation technologies, such as autonomous vehicles and electric vehicles, poses a financial challenge for governments and companies.

  2. Privacy and Security Concerns With the rise of connected vehicles and intelligent transportation systems, concerns regarding data privacy and cybersecurity have increased. Ensuring the protection of sensitive data transmitted between vehicles, infrastructure, and traffic management systems is critical for the continued growth of the smart transportation market.

  3. Regulatory and Legal Hurdles The widespread adoption of autonomous vehicles and smart transportation systems is hindered by regulatory challenges. Governments need to develop and implement clear regulations regarding the operation of autonomous vehicles, smart infrastructure, and the safety standards required for these technologies to be deployed effectively.


Competitor Analysis


The smart transportation market is highly competitive, with key players in the industry constantly innovating to offer advanced solutions. Some of the prominent companies in the smart transportation market include:

  1. Cisco Systems, Inc. :Cisco provides cutting-edge technology solutions for smart cities, including intelligent traffic management, connected vehicle systems, and network infrastructure. The company is actively involved in enabling the development of smart transportation networks worldwide.

  2. General Electric Company :GE offers smart transportation solutions, including intelligent lighting systems, connected vehicle technologies, and infrastructure for smart cities. GE’s focus on sustainability and innovation in transportation has positioned it as a key player in the market.

  3. IBM Corporation :IBM has been at the forefront of developing smart city and transportation solutions, including AI-driven traffic management systems, analytics for urban mobility, and data integration platforms. IBM's solutions help cities optimize their transportation systems and improve traffic flow.

  4. Alstom SA :Alstom is a leading provider of transportation infrastructure solutions, including electric and autonomous transportation systems. The company focuses on providing sustainable and efficient transportation solutions that align with the principles of smart cities.

  5. Others :Other companies in the smart transportation market include Siemens AG, Qualcomm Technologies, Inc., and Honeywell International, Inc., all of which are innovating in connected vehicle solutions, smart traffic management, and transportation infrastructure.
